Skip to main content
Drupal API
User account menu
  • Log in

Breadcrumb

  1. Drupal Core 11.1.x
  2. DoctrineCaster.php

function DoctrineCaster::castOrmProxy

File

vendor/symfony/var-dumper/Caster/DoctrineCaster.php, line 40

Class

DoctrineCaster
Casts Doctrine related classes to array representation.

Namespace

Symfony\Component\VarDumper\Caster

Code

public static function castOrmProxy(OrmProxy $proxy, array $a, Stub $stub, bool $isNested) : array {
    foreach ([
        '_entityPersister',
        '_identifier',
    ] as $k) {
        if (\array_key_exists($k = "\x00Doctrine\\ORM\\Proxy\\Proxy\x00" . $k, $a)) {
            unset($a[$k]);
            ++$stub->cut;
        }
    }
    return $a;
}

API Navigation

  • Drupal Core 11.1.x
  • Topics
  • Classes
  • Functions
  • Constants
  • Globals
  • Files
  • Namespaces
  • Deprecated
  • Services
RSS feed
Powered by Drupal